WebStrain Rotation with Mohr's Circle. In addition to identifying principal strain and maximum shear strain, Mohr's circle can be used to graphically rotate the strain state. This involves a number of steps. On the horizontal axis, plot the circle center at ε avg = (ε x + ε y )/2. Plot the either the point (ε x , γ xy /2) or (ε y , -γ xy /2).
